Transaction 62fa5855363021ae4d968ca04e8ea604cc124074cdc1ae54be09a7df08de9b7a
1 Input
-
095ccb77aa5ae59836db72c8b9ee83adf634e5b6cb78d404d873097a468c10cd:2
OP_DATA_48(48) 440220721c28a2bc6af57cd4d74dedf7ae21ab9644ace147c17c48c7a47479ba5b0143022033043c07979f461254d583
1 Outputs
- 62fa5855363021ae4d968ca04e8ea604cc124074cdc1ae54be09a7df08de9b7a:0
value 139506
address 3C42FohauJJKwUTC39shVHoe2Lh12LEkC7